Output dab8fe5e1c3f2eae098c6847754aa2af5cfad59ca4d910b7c6ab306d4205daba:1

value
26476189
script pubkey
OP_0 OP_PUSHBYTES_20 625be342fd4fe51d4da92a37bc9967ab92db860e
address
bc1qvfd7xshaflj36ndf9gmmext84wfdhpswq568u6
transaction
dab8fe5e1c3f2eae098c6847754aa2af5cfad59ca4d910b7c6ab306d4205daba
spent
true